Boost Your Mornings: 8 Quick Breakfast Ideas for Busy Lives

Quick breakfast ideas: poached egg with vegetables and rye bread.

Boost Your Mornings: 8 Quick Breakfast Ideas for Busy Lives

For health-conscious individuals, starting the day with a nutritious meal can make all the difference in energy levels and overall wellness. Yet, mornings can often feel frantic, leaving us scrambling for time to prepare a healthy breakfast. Luckily, there are simple, delicious options that anyone can prepare in less than 10 minutes. Here are eight easy breakfast ideas that fit perfectly into a busy lifestyle, ensuring you fuel your day the right way.

Coffee Smoothie: Your Morning Pick-Me-Up

If you often find yourself choosing between coffee and breakfast, why not combine them? A coffee smoothie can be whipped up in just 5 minutes and is packed with energy-boosting nutrients. Blend together bananas, almond butter, and cold brew coffee for a rich, satisfying drink. Freezing coffee in an ice cube tray and tossing it in the blender not only adds a cool texture but also enhances the coffee flavor. This drink allows you to enjoy two essential morning rituals in one.

Spinach Feta Breakfast Wrap: A Nutritious Handheld Delight

Take inspiration from your favorite café and make a spinach feta breakfast wrap at home. With ingredients like egg whites, feta cheese, cream cheese, and sun-dried tomatoes, you can create a flavorful wrap that tastes incredible and keeps in the fridge for up to three days. Freeze a few for easy heating on the busiest of mornings. It’s a hearty option that satisfies without the high price of takeout—best of all, you control the ingredients!

Mediterranean Breakfast Toast: Savory Simplicity

The Mediterranean diet is renowned for its health advantages, making it a perfect source of breakfast inspiration. Start with whole-grain or sourdough bread and load up on toppings like avocado, tomatoes, olives, and a sprinkle of feta. This toast combines fuel with flavor, creating a wholesome breakfast that supports heart health and keeps you feeling full longer.

Overnight Oats: Prep Ahead for a Smooth Morning

One of the simplest make-ahead options is overnight oats. Combine oats with Greek yogurt, chia seeds, and your favorite fruits in a jar the night before. By morning, you'll have a creamy, delicious breakfast waiting for you. This breakfast packs protein and fiber, keeping you energized. For added flavor, consider adding honey or maple syrup, or even spices like cinnamon to elevate the taste.

Cottage Cheese and Fruit: A Sweet Protein Punch

A classic combination that never goes out of style is cottage cheese with fruit. This dish is not only easy to put together but also delivers a significant protein boost. Try it with pineapple, berries, or peaches—whatever fruit you have on hand. Top it with a sprinkle of nuts or seeds for a little crunch, and you've got a quick, nutritious breakfast that’s also a treat for the senses.

Healthy Cereal with Nut Butter: A Crunchy Option

If you’re in the mood for something crunchy, grab a bowl of healthy cereal topped with nut butter. Choose a low-sugar, whole grain cereal and add almond or peanut butter for healthy fats. Pair it with low-fat milk or a dairy alternative to ramp up nutrition and satiate your hunger. This timeless breakfast continues to hold the title for ease and health benefits, especially when rushed for time.

Dinner Leftovers: A Savvy Shortcut

It may sound unconventional, but leftovers can be great breakfast options! If you have nutritious dinner options on hand, such as roasted vegetables or lean proteins, simply reheat them for a quick meal. This not only saves time in the kitchen but ensures you maintain a balanced diet. Leftover stir-fries with rice or quinoa can even be dressed up with a fried egg on top for a complete breakfast.

How Freeze-Dried Smoothies Can Take Your Flavor Game To New Heights!

Update Discovering the Magic of Freeze-Dried Smoothies Imagine taking your beloved smoothie recipes and turning them into crunchy, delicious treats! Freeze-dried smoothies are an innovative new way to enjoy all the flavors you love without the need for blending. With freeze-dried fruit as a key ingredient, you can achieve a unique texture and maintain the nutrients that make smoothies an excellent choice for health enthusiasts. What’s So Special About Freeze-Drying? Freeze-drying is a process that preserves essential nutrients while transforming fresh fruits into a crunchy snack. According to reputable dietitians, this method retains up to 90% of fruits' original nutrients. This means that when you incorporate freeze-dried fruits into smoothies, they're not just tasty—they're packed with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that your body craves. Mixing It Up: Flavor Combinations to Try! One of the joys of smoothies is experimenting with different fruit combinations. With freeze-dried fruits, the options are endless! You can blend tropical flavors like mango and pineapple with freeze-dried raspberries for a sweet twist, or go for classic combos like strawberry-banana. The charming crunch brings an exciting textural dimension to every sip. Health Benefits of Including Freeze-Dried Ingredients Incorporating freeze-dried fruits into your smoothies not only enhances flavor but also boosts nutrition. They provide fiber, which is essential for digestive health, and can help regulate your appetite. When you're looking for a quick snack that satisfies your sweet tooth while delivering on health benefits, freeze-dried fruits serve as an excellent choice without excessive added sugars. How to Make Your Own Freeze-Dried Smoothie Making a freeze-dried smoothie is simpler than you think. Start by creating your ideal smoothie with fresh or frozen ingredients, then pour the mixture onto large sheets suitable for freeze-drying. After a few hours in the freeze-dryer, you'll have a crunchy smoothie that's portable and perfect for on-the-go munching! Take Your Smoothies Anywhere! Another perk of freeze-dried smoothies is their portability. They’re easy to pack for lunch, road trips, or any outing. Unlike traditional smoothies, you can toss these crunchy bites in your bag without worrying about spills. Plus, they maintain their flavor and nutrition, making them a great snack for any time of day.
